What's the difference between deep tissue and sports massage?
Deep tissue uses strong, sustained pressure to release chronic tension and knots built up over time. Sports massage focuses on muscle groups used in athletic activity, improving mobility and preventing injury. Both use similar pressure, but the focus and technique differ based on your needs.
